Transaction 39f65964c9a413bbfcc4b64e48a5ea28a05c0c29ee2c8037b3ea57b0fbd10ffe
1 Input
1 Output
-
39f65964c9a413bbfcc4b64e48a5ea28a05c0c29ee2c8037b3ea57b0fbd10ffe:0
- value
- 22960
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ca8034b8ba7d7d9e27e4149dbe174144451d0243
- address
- bc1qe2qrfw96047euflyzjwmu96pg3z36qjr4xel74